The essence and content of the institutional and legal provision of social security of a person is revealed, the peculiarities of social security of a person in the conditions of war are investigated, the assistance provided by volunteers, international organizations and European states is considered. It was determined that the system of social protection in Ukraine is differentiated, consists of three levels, its passive form dominates, and the legal framework for ensuring the social security of the population is divided into six groups and is scattered, therefore the current legislation is ineffective and has a mainly declarative nature. Financial provision of social protection of citizens has a multi-channel structure. The dynamics of the share of expenditures of the consolidated budget of Ukraine on social protection and social security in the GDP were analyzed. The research used a systematic approach, the method of structural analysis, grouping and tabular method, logical generalization to justify the institutional-legal and financial-economic provision of human social security in war conditions. It is substantiated that the financial component of social protection of the population is negatively affected by the imperfection of the regulatory and legal framework. Accordingly, the financing of social protection of the population in Ukraine is accompanied by a number of deep problems and shortcomings, which is connected with the increase in the number of various social benefits and benefits against the background of the emergence of new forms of social risks and increased marginalization. The proper functioning of the social protection system and the support of war-affected persons remains one of the challenges for Ukraine in the extraordinary conditions.
